Transitional Protection is different for different people. That is based on whichever legacy benefits you were getting before migrating.
If you're getting New Style ESA alongside UC then most of your total payment will come through ESA. The UC deduction will be around £610 a month.
So if you're a single person over 25 then a very rough estimate would be around £400 a month through UC. (Plus whatever your LHA pays for Housing Element if you get housing costs.)
